The winning entry\u2014authored by Image Merchants Promotion Limited\u2014documents the visionary PR reforms led by Comptroller-General Bashir Adewale Adeniyi, MFR, and has become a benchmark for public relations scholarship in Nigeria.<\/p>\n<p>Philip Sheppard, IPRA Secretary-General, praised the publication for offering actionable strategies and showcasing real-world PR leadership rooted in NCS\u2019s transformation journey.<\/p>\n<p>Receiving the award on behalf of the Service, Assistant Comptroller Abdullahi Maiwada, NCS\u2019s National PRO, expressed gratitude, noting that the honour reinforces the Service\u2019s commitment to transparency, professionalism, and stakeholder engagement.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cThis award is a validation of the Nigeria Customs Service&#8217;s commitment to professionalism, transparency, and stakeholder engagement,&#8221; Maiwada said. &#8220;Under the leadership of the Comptroller-General, we have repositioned communication as a strategic tool for reform trust-building.\u201d <\/p>\n<p>It will be recalled that the Service was earlier honoured in 2024 with the prestigious GWA for Crisis Communication at the IPRA Gala in Belgrade, Serbia. This year\u2019s award builds on that feat, highlighting NCS\u2019s consistent innovation in communication and reputation management.<\/p>\n<p>The award ceremony formed part of the Public Relations Knowledge Sharing Conference held from Wednesday, 1st to Friday, 3rd October 2025, at the Accra International Conference Centre. The conference, themed \u201cGlobal Realities and Innovative Communication,\u201d was attended by leading communication experts, including Dr Ike Neliaku, President of the Nigerian Institute of Public Relations (NIPR); Nata\u0161a Pavlovi\u0107 Bujas, President of IPRA; Arik Karani, President of the African Public Relations Association (APRA); and Esther Amba Numaba Cobbah, President of the Institute of Public Relations (IPR), Ghana, among other PR professionals across Africa.<\/p>\n<p>At the closing session of the conference earlier on Friday, the President of Ghana, His Excellency John Dramani Mahama, urged public relations professionals to uphold the highest standards of ethics and competence in their practice.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cAs communicators, you hold the power to shape narratives and influence public trust,\u201d President Mahama said. \u201cOur continent needs professionals who communicate with integrity, clarity, and purpose to support national development.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>Also speaking at the Gala night, Ghana\u2019s Vice President, H.E. Jane Nana, congratulated all the awardees, commending their contributions to advancing strategic communication globally.<\/p>\n<p>To crown the night, Esther Amba Numaba Cobbah, President of the Institute of Public Relations (IPR), Ghana, assumed the mantle as the new President of the International Public Relations Association (IPRA), succeeding Nata\u0161a Pavlovi\u0107 Bujas.
